How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Montréal?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Montréal Studio Apartments | $1,404 | $790 | $2,656 |
| Montréal 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,029 | $700 | $10,000+ |
| Montréal 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,554 | $1,113 | $10,000+ |
| Montréal 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,150 | $700 | $8,783 |
| Montréal 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,497 | $1,074 | $10,000+ |
| Montréal 5 Bedroom Apartments | $3,683 | $700 | $8,365 |
| Montréal 6 Bedroom Apartments | $7,899 | $4,200 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Montréal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Montréal with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Montréal is at Parc Cite listed at $599.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Montréal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Montréal is $2,029.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Montréal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Montréal is a 1,798 square feet unit starting from $11,000 at Le Samuel.
What is the average size for Montréal 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Montréal is currently 608 sq ft.
